Ajax loading error при обновлении joomla

Ошибка «Ajax loading error» может возникнуть при обновлении системы управления сайтом Joomla и может привести к неполадкам в работе сайта. Эта ошибка связана с проблемами загрузки данных с использованием AJAX-технологии.

В данной статье мы рассмотрим основные причины возникновения ошибки «Ajax loading error» при обновлении Joomla и предложим несколько возможных решений. Мы также рассмотрим способы предотвращения данной ошибки и дадим советы по устранению связанных с ней проблем. Узнайте, как избежать проблем с обновлением Joomla и обеспечить бесперебойную работу вашего сайта.

Ошибка загрузки Ajax при обновлении Joomla: причины и решения

При обновлении Joomla иногда пользователи сталкиваются с ошибкой загрузки Ajax. Это может быть очень разочаровывающим и создавать проблемы с функциональностью сайта. В этой статье мы рассмотрим причины этой ошибки и предложим несколько решений для ее устранения.

Причины ошибки загрузки Ajax

Ошибка загрузки Ajax обычно связана с проблемами взаимодействия между клиентом и сервером. Некоторые из наиболее распространенных причин этой ошибки включают:

  • Проблемы с подключением к серверу: нестабильное интернет-соединение, слишком долгое время ожидания ответа от сервера или несовместимость протокола (HTTP или HTTPS).
  • Проблемы на стороне сервера: неправильные настройки или конфигурация сервера, недостаток ресурсов сервера, ограничения веб-хостинга или блокировка запросов Ajax.
  • Проблемы с кодом JavaScript или компонентами Joomla: ошибка в коде JavaScript, отсутствие или повреждение нужных файлов, конфликт между различными компонентами или плагинами.

Решения ошибки загрузки Ajax

Чтобы исправить ошибку загрузки Ajax, вы можете попробовать следующие решения:

  1. Проверьте подключение к интернету и стабильность сети. Попробуйте обновить страницу или перезагрузить маршрутизатор, чтобы устранить проблемы с подключением.
  2. Проверьте настройки сервера и убедитесь, что они правильные. Обратитесь к вашему веб-хостинг-провайдеру, чтобы узнать о возможных ограничениях или блокировках запросов Ajax.
  3. Проверьте код JavaScript на наличие ошибок и конфликтов с другими компонентами или плагинами. Используйте инструменты разработчика браузера, чтобы увидеть сообщения об ошибках.
  4. Переустановите или обновите компоненты Joomla, которые могут вызывать проблемы. Убедитесь, что все файлы компонента находятся на своих местах и не повреждены.
  5. Если ничего из вышеперечисленного не помогло, обратитесь за помощью к специалистам Joomla или форумам сообщества, где вы можете получить более точные инструкции и рекомендации.

Важно помнить, что ошибка загрузки Ajax может иметь разную природу и решение проблемы может зависеть от вашей конкретной ситуации. Будьте внимательны и тщательно анализируйте причины возникновения ошибки, чтобы выбрать наиболее подходящее решение.

How to Fix the «Error Decoding JSON Data: Syntax Error» in Joomla When Logging into the Admin Area

Понимание ошибки загрузки Ajax

Ошибки загрузки Ajax являются распространенной проблемой при разработке веб-приложений. Для понимания этой ошибки необходимо разобраться, что такое Ajax и как он работает.

Ajax — это технология, которая позволяет веб-страницам обмениваться данными с сервером без необходимости перезагрузки всей страницы. Он использует язык JavaScript для отправки запросов на сервер и получения ответов. Это позволяет создавать динамические и отзывчивые веб-приложения без сильной нагрузки на сервер.

Как работает Ajax?

Первоначально JavaScript создает XMLHttpRequest-объект, который используется для отправки запросов на сервер. Затем JavaScript отправляет этот запрос на сервер и ожидает ответа. При получении ответа от сервера, JavaScript может обновить содержимое страницы без перезагрузки.

Однако при использовании Ajax могут возникать ошибки загрузки, которые могут быть вызваны различными причинами:

  • Проблемы в коде JavaScript: Ошибка может возникнуть, если в коде JavaScript есть опечатки, неправильное использование функций или переменных или другие синтаксические ошибки.
  • Проблемы на стороне сервера: Ошибка может возникнуть, если на сервере произошла ошибка или сервер не смог обработать запрос.
  • Проблемы с сетью: Ошибка может возникнуть, если есть проблемы с подключением к Интернету или если сервер не может быть достигнут по какой-либо причине.

Как исправить ошибку загрузки Ajax?

Для исправления ошибки загрузки Ajax необходимо сначала определить причину ошибки. Для этого можно воспользоваться инструментами разработчика в браузере, чтобы проверить код JavaScript и получить информацию о запросе и ответе на сервер.

Если ошибка связана с кодом JavaScript, необходимо внимательно просмотреть код и исправить все ошибки. Если ошибка связана с проблемами на стороне сервера, необходимо проверить логи сервера и убедиться, что сервер может обработать запросы правильно. Если ошибка связана с проблемами с сетью, необходимо проверить подключение к Интернету и убедиться, что сервер доступен.

В большинстве случаев, исправление ошибки загрузки Ajax сводится к исправлению проблем в коде JavaScript или на сервере. Однако, в редких случаях, может потребоваться обратиться к разработчику или технической поддержке для получения помощи.

Возможные причины ошибки при обновлении Joomla

Ошибки при обновлении Joomla могут возникать по разным причинам, их важно разобрать и устранить, чтобы успешно выполнить обновление системы. В данной статье мы рассмотрим основные причины возникновения ошибок при обновлении Joomla и как их можно исправить.

1. Неправильные разрешения на файлы и директории

Одной из возможных причин ошибок при обновлении Joomla являются неправильные разрешения на файлы и директории. Если у вас недостаточно прав для чтения, записи или выполнения файлов в процессе обновления, это может привести к ошибкам. Убедитесь, что у вас правильно установлены разрешения на файлы и директории в соответствии с рекомендациями Joomla.

2. Старая версия Joomla или расширений

Еще одной причиной ошибок при обновлении может быть наличие старой версии Joomla или расширений. Если у вас установлена устаревшая версия системы или расширений, возникают конфликты и несовместимость с обновлением. Перед обновлением убедитесь, что у вас установлена последняя версия Joomla и всех необходимых расширений.

3. Неправильно настроенные серверные параметры

Еще одной возможной причиной ошибок при обновлении Joomla является неправильная конфигурация серверных параметров. Некорректные настройки сервера могут привести к проблемам с обновлением. Рекомендуется обратиться к хостинг-провайдеру или системному администратору для проверки и настройки сервера с учетом требований Joomla.

4. Конфликты с другими расширениями или шаблонами

Также ошибки при обновлении Joomla могут возникать из-за конфликтов с другими установленными расширениями или шаблонами. Несовместимость между различными компонентами системы может привести к ошибкам при обновлении. Перед обновлением рекомендуется отключить временно все расширения и использовать стандартный шаблон для проверки наличия конфликтов.

5. Проблемы с Интернет-соединением

Наконец, проблемы с Интернет-соединением также могут быть причиной ошибок при обновлении Joomla. Если ваше соединение нестабильно или медленное, процесс обновления может быть прерван или поврежден. Убедитесь, что у вас стабильное и быстрое Интернет-соединение перед обновлением Joomla.

Ошибки при обновлении Joomla могут возникать по разным причинам, и их важно правильно определить и устранить. При возникновении ошибок рекомендуется внимательно проверить разрешения на файлы и директории, обновить Joomla и ее расширения, настроить серверные параметры, проверить наличие конфликтов с другими расширениями и шаблонами, а также убедиться в стабильности Интернет-соединения. Это поможет вам успешно выполнить обновление Joomla и избежать ошибок.

Ошибка Ajax loading error: как ее устранить

Ошибка Ajax loading error является довольно распространенной проблемой при обновлении Joomla. Она указывает на то, что возникла проблема при загрузке данных с помощью технологии Ajax. Возможные причины этой ошибки могут быть разными, но в большинстве случаев она связана с конфликтами между компонентами или модулями, неправильными настройками сервера или ошибками в коде.

Для устранения ошибки Ajax loading error можно предпринять следующие шаги:

1. Проверить конфликты между компонентами и модулями

Первым шагом следует проверить, возникает ли ошибка на всех страницах вашего сайта или только на определенных. Если ошибка проявляется только на определенных страницах, то это может указывать на конфликты между компонентами или модулями. Попробуйте отключить некоторые компоненты или модули и проверить, исчезнет ли ошибка. Если ошибка исчезает, то вам нужно будет исключить конфликтные компоненты или модули путем поочередного включения их и проверки результата.

2. Проверить настройки сервера

Другой возможной причиной ошибки Ajax loading error может быть неправильная конфигурация сервера. Проверьте настройки PHP и убедитесь, что все необходимые расширения включены. Также может быть полезно проверить файлы журнала ошибок сервера для поиска каких-либо сообщений об ошибках, связанных с Ajax.

3. Проверить код

Если проблема не связана с конфликтами между компонентами или модулями, а также с настройками сервера, то стоит обратить внимание на код вашего сайта. Проверьте все Ajax-запросы на наличие ошибок или неправильных настроек. Убедитесь, что все URL-адреса и параметры передаются правильно и соответствуют требованиям вашего компонента или модуля.

Ошибка Ajax loading error может быть вызвана разными причинами, и для ее устранения часто требуется систематический подход. Следуйте указанным выше шагам, чтобы выяснить, в чем именно проблема и как исправить ее. Если у вас возникают трудности, не стесняйтесь обратиться за помощью к специалистам или сообществу Joomla для получения дополнительной поддержки.

Проверка наличия подключенных библиотек и модулей Ajax

При разработке веб-приложений, особенно с использованием фреймворков, таких как Joomla, важно убедиться, что все необходимые библиотеки и модули Ajax правильно подключены. Ajax (Asynchronous JavaScript and XML) – это технология, которая позволяет обновлять части веб-страницы без перезагрузки всей страницы. Она широко используется для создания интерактивных и динамических пользовательских интерфейсов.

Проверка наличия подключенных библиотек Ajax

Перед началом работы с Ajax необходимо убедиться, что соответствующая библиотека правильно подключена. В случае Joomla, обычно используется библиотека jQuery, которая является одной из самых популярных и широко поддерживаемых библиотек Ajax.

Для проверки наличия подключенной библиотеки jQuery, необходимо открыть консоль разработчика в браузере (обычно можно сделать, нажав F12) и выполнить следующую команду:

$("body").hasOwnProperty('ajax');

Если результатом выполнения команды будет true, это означает, что jQuery и, следовательно, библиотека Ajax успешно подключены. В противном случае, возможно, имеет место ошибка в подключении библиотеки либо ее отсутствие.

Проверка наличия подключенных модулей Ajax

Помимо библиотек, веб-приложения могут использовать различные модули Ajax для выполнения определенных задач. Такие модули могут быть подключены отдельно от библиотеки Ajax и могут предоставлять дополнительные функциональные возможности.

Наличие подключенных модулей Ajax можно проверить с помощью следующего кода:

if (typeof AjaxModuleName !== 'undefined') {
// модуль Ajax подключен, выполнять соответствующий код
} else {
// модуль Ajax не подключен, выполнять альтернативный код
}

В данном примере мы проверяем, определена ли переменная AjaxModuleName, которая обычно указывает на наличие определенного модуля Ajax. Если переменная определена, это означает, что модуль успешно подключен. В противном случае, можно выполнить альтернативный код.

Проверка наличия подключенных библиотек и модулей Ajax является важным этапом при разработке веб-приложений. Она позволяет предотвратить ошибки и убедиться в правильном функционировании интерактивных элементов на странице.

Обновление Joomla и решение ошибки Ajax loading error

Обновление Joomla — это важный шаг для обеспечения безопасности и стабильной работы вашего сайта. При обновлении может возникнуть ошибка «Ajax loading error», которая может показаться сложной для новичков, но на самом деле ее можно легко решить. В этой статье я расскажу вам о причинах этой ошибки и предложу несколько решений.

Причины ошибки Ajax loading error при обновлении Joomla

Ошибка «Ajax loading error» может возникнуть по нескольким причинам. Возможно, ваш сервер не поддерживает технологию Ajax, которая используется в Joomla. Также, ошибка может быть связана с неправильной конфигурацией или несовместимостью расширений и шаблонов после обновления.

Решение ошибки Ajax loading error

Для начала, рекомендуется проверить, поддерживает ли ваш сервер технологию Ajax. Для этого можно создать простой Ajax-скрипт и запустить его на вашем сервере. Если скрипт работает без ошибок, то проблема скорее всего не в поддержке Ajax на вашем сервере.

Если проблема не в поддержке Ajax на сервере, следующим шагом будет проверка конфигурации и обновление расширений и шаблонов. Проверьте, что у вас установлена последняя версия Joomla, а также обновите все установленные расширения и шаблоны.

Если обновление Joomla и расширений не помогло, попробуйте отключить все расширения и шаблоны, кроме стандартных. Затем постепенно включайте каждое расширение и шаблон, чтобы определить, какое из них вызывает ошибку. Если вы определите конкретное расширение или шаблон, свяжитесь с разработчиком для получения помощи или обновленной версии.

Если вы все еще получаете ошибку после всех этих шагов, рекомендуется обратиться к команде поддержки Joomla или к сообществу для получения помощи. Они смогут провести более подробную диагностику проблемы и предложить индивидуальное решение.

Ошибка «Ajax loading error» при обновлении Joomla может быть вызвана несколькими причинами, но ее можно легко решить. Проверьте поддержку Ajax на вашем сервере, обновите Joomla и расширения, а также отключите и включайте расширения и шаблоны для определения причины ошибки. Если все остальное не помогло, обратитесь за помощью к команде поддержки или сообществу Joomla.

Проверка наличия конфликтов с другими расширениями или шаблонами

При возникновении ошибки «Ajax loading error» при обновлении Joomla, одной из причин может быть конфликт с другими установленными расширениями или шаблонами. Чтобы устранить эту проблему, необходимо выполнить проверку и решить возможные конфликты.

Вот несколько шагов, которые помогут вам определить и устранить конфликты на вашем сайте Joomla:

1. Отключите все установленные расширения

Первым шагом является отключение всех установленных расширений на вашем сайте. Для этого зайдите в административную панель Joomla и выберите «Расширения» -> «Управление расширениями». Затем выберите все расширения, отметив их флажками, и нажмите на кнопку «Отключить». После этого проверьте, возникает ли ошибка «Ajax loading error» при обновлении Joomla. Если ошибка исчезает, значит, одно из отключенных расширений вызывало конфликт. Теперь вам нужно включать расширения по одному и обновлять Joomla после каждого включения, чтобы определить, какое именно расширение вызывает проблему.

2. Включите стандартный шаблон Joomla

Если отключение расширений не решило проблему, следующим шагом является включение стандартного шаблона Joomla. Для этого зайдите в административную панель Joomla и выберите «Оформление» -> «Управление шаблонами». Затем выберите стандартный шаблон Joomla и нажмите на кнопку «Включить». После этого проверьте, возникает ли ошибка «Ajax loading error» при обновлении Joomla. Если ошибка исчезает, это указывает на конфликт с вашим текущим шаблоном. Вам нужно будет решить этот конфликт, например, обратиться к разработчику шаблона или использовать другой шаблон.

3. Профессиональная помощь

Если вы не смогли определить причину ошибки «Ajax loading error» после выполнения вышеуказанных шагов, рекомендуется обратиться за профессиональной помощью. Специалисты смогут провести более глубокий анализ вашего сайта и найти причину конфликтов.

Рейтинг
( Пока оценок нет )
Загрузка ...